KING: It's always great to welcome Dr. Laura Schlessinger to LARRY
KING LIVE, the nationally syndicated radio talk show host, "New York
Times" best selling author, nine "New York Times" best sellers. Her
newest now in trade paper is "The Proper Care and Feeding of
Marriage." There you see its cover.

We'll cover lots of bases. We'll get to the book, of course.

DR. LAURA SCHLESSINGER, AUTHOR "THE PROPER CARE AND FEEDING OF
MARRIAGE": Sure.

KING: What's your view of the elections so far?

SCHLESSINGER: Oh, my gosh, nasty spatting. The thing that worries me
the most, I read in the "Wall Street Journal" this morning, they were
analyzing how Hillary came in front at the last minute and they were
analyzing who did what from the exit polls. They said the women came
to vote. OK?

Then I watch a news piece where they show a black reporter in a hair
shop, barber shop, run by a black proprietor, and they're talking
about blacks voting for Obama. The thing I worry about the most is
people not voting for somebody because they're black, not voting for
somebody because they're a woman, not voting for somebody because
they're a Mormon or a Jew. I'm equally worried about somebody voting
for all of those simply because they're that.

KING: Or vote for someone because they're white.

SCHLESSINGER: It doesn't matter whether you will or won't, it has to
be the person. This is the leader of the free world. This is the
person who is going to protect this country from international
jihadism, and we need somebody who can do the job. We can't say, like
Hillary said evidently in one news report I heard, that are you an
agent of change -- because Obama's doing the change thing -- and she
said well, I would be a woman in office. That is a change.

That can't be the reason anybody's in office. I wouldn't vote for
somebody because they have a uterus.

KING: What do we mean, "The Proper Care and Feeding of Marriage?"

SCHLESSINGER: Well, I wrote "The Proper Care and Feeding of Husbands,"
because it was really clear -- since I did the show with you and we
talked about that. We talked about the growing diminishment of respect
for men, for husbands, for fathers, children of children, and that
didn't make marriages very happy. And I wanted women to be happy. I am
a woman. I want women to be happy.

And so I used that book to show them how adoring their man and
respecting their man and being sensitive about his feelings and his
needs made you happier and got more out of him. The obvious second
part was to bring the entire thing together to show both men and
women, regardless of the gender, how to bring pleasure into a marriage
and make a marriage last. Because I get so many calls with people
saying, I'm jealous, maybe my wife, my husband is looking at somebody
else.

You know what? If you are the most loving, wonderful person to them,
if you were adoring and sweet and kind and thoughtful and considerate
and sexy, and all of that with them, nobody can drag them away from
you.

KING: Is this for women?

SCHLESSINGER: No, this is for men and women.

KING: OK, why is marriage so difficult?

SCHLESSINGER: Because people are not living to make the other person
appreciate that they're being alive and that they're with you. When
you wake up in the morning and turn over and look at that person and
give the thought to, what can I do to make that person happy they're
alive, and married to me? If we're thinking about what we can give and
two people are doing that, like the lift of the Maji (ph), the O'Henry
story, then you have two happy people, even though there might be
financial issues, kids are sick, relatives are crazy.

KING: That's obviously the perfect ideal. But why doesn't it occur?

SCHLESSINGER: I think because we don't support that enough. We support
mostly in our society how you feel about your day, and are your needs
being met. If I could think of one reason that people give me, time
and time and time again on the show when I ask them why they had the
affair or why they hurt their feelings, it's because, I wasn't getting
my needs met. It's all about what I'm not getting. And people have
forgotten that getting married is a pledge to make somebody else's
life worth living.

Vets in Prision more likely Sex Offenders than non-vets

WASHINGTON --Military veterans in prison are more than twice as
likely to have been convicted for sex offenses as nonveteran inmates,
federal researchers say. They cannot say why.

A study released Sunday by the Bureau of Justice Statistics
compared the populations of inmates who served in the military and
those who did not.

Veterans are half as likely to be incarcerated as those without
service experience in the first place, researchers found, but 23
percent of the veterans in prison were sex offenders, compared with 9
percent of nonveteran inmates.

"We couldn't come to any definite conclusion as to why," said
Margaret E. Noonan, one of the study's authors.

The numbers mirror a trend seen in military prisons, where
populations have declined but sexual assault remains the most common
crime.

"I don't want people to come away from this thinking veterans are
crazed sex offenders," Noonan said. "I want them to understand that
veterans are less likely to be in prison in the first place."

The incarceration rate for veterans is 630 per 100,000, compared to
1,390 per 100,000 for nonveterans. More than 90 percent of U.S.
veterans are male and 99 percent of the veterans in prison are male.

The study found that veterans in prison were older, more educated,
more likely to have been married and more likely than nonveterans to
be incarcerated for violent crimes or offenses against women or
children.
